All subscribers will receive a news brief of information and resources via email once a month from September through May, excluding December.
Each news brief will highlight a key topic in education related to supporting the learning needs of all students.
The news brief is a collaborative effort of the Virginia Department of Education Training and Technical Assistance Centers at James Madison University and George Mason University.
